Chinese Journal of Trauma ; (12): 1143-1148, 2013.
Artigo em Chinês | WPRIM | ID: wpr-439195

RESUMO

Objective To investigate causes and treatments for a fracture of the contralateral femoral neck in the elderly with prosthetic replacement for femoral neck fractures.Methods A retrospective analysis was conducted on 85 cases undergone prosthetic replacement for femoral neck fractures between March 2005 and May 2012,including 12 cases in secondary replacement group due to fractures of the contralateral uninjured femoral neck after primary prosthetic replacement and 73 cases in primary replacement group.Variables were compared between the two groups including causes of injury,age,sex,bone density,complications,quality of life,Harris score of the contralateral hip joint,surgical choice.Refracture reasons were evaluated and treatment plans were proposed.Results Immediate cause of injury in all cases was falling.Primary and secondary replacement groups showed mean age of (68.82 ± 5.18) yearsvs (76.83 ± 3.64) years (P<0.05),male to female ratio of 0.66:1 vs 0.09:1 (P<0.05),and bone mineral density of (0.507 ± 0.062) g/cm2 vs (0.461 ± 0.095) g/cm2(P <0.05).Moreover,cases in the two groups suffered from the associated complications (hypertension,diabetes mellitus,cataract,stroke,rheumatoid arthritis,and Parkinson' s disease).Except for the diabetes mellitus,incidence of the other five basic diseases presented significance differences between the two groups (P < 0.05).Of primary and secondary replacement groups,quality of life was (76.26 ±14.17) points vs (67.86 ± 16.74) points (P < 0.05) ; Harris score of the contralateral hip was (98.66 ±1.39) points vs (90.75 ± 5.39) points (P < O.05).For treatment choice,32 total hip arthroplasty (THA) and 41 femoral head arthroplasty (FHA) with cement fixation in 44 cases and cementless fixation in 29 cases were performed in primary replacement group; two total hip arthroplasty and 10 femoral head arthroplasty with cement fixation in 11 cases and cementless fixation in one were performed in secondary placement group (P < 0.05).Conclusions Fall remains the immediate cause of the contralateral fractures following prosthetic replacement of femoral neck fractures in the elderly.Aging,females,bone density reduction,high-incidence of complications,decreased quality of life,and joint function impairment after the primary prosthetic replacement are unfavorable factors.Prosthetic replacement is still the preferred choice of treatment and surgical procedure is more likely to be the simple cemented FHA.

Chinese Journal of Primary Medicine and Pharmacy ; (12): 2137-2139, 2013.
Artigo em Chinês | WPRIM | ID: wpr-434608

RESUMO

Objective To observe the clinical effect of microsurgical repair of Gustilo Ⅲ C floating knee injuries.Methods Ten patients with Gustilo Ⅲ C floating knee injuries were treated by operation.10 wounded limbs were classified according to Fraser classification:Ⅱ a in 3 cases,Ⅱb 2 cases,Ⅱ c 5 cases.All cases were taken the treatment of microsurgical repair combined with external fixation and fascia compartment extensive decompression.Results 8cases survived,and Phase Ⅱ amputation were procedured in 2 cases.All the patients were followed up for 6 to 36 months.There were 8 cases osseous healing,including 1 case delay union and 2 cases non-union cured by bone graft,1 case was treated with knee arthrodesis for traumatic arthritis.Tissue flap all survived with good texture,colour and lustre.5 cases had fine appearance and function.1 case had fistula form and was cured after changing medicine.Conclusion Gustilo Ⅲ C floating knee injuries can endanger the survival and function of the limbs,and the healing keys were backbone vascular reconstruction of injury limb and repair of nerve damage and soft tissue defect.Using microsurgical technique to repair and rebuild can improve the clinical efficacy.
